An Egyptian mission has discovered a military fort at Tell el-Abqain (Beheira Governorate), in the north-west Delta. The fort was a key military outpost on the western military road, an area prone to attack by Libyan tribes, and later the ‘Sea Peoples’.

The fort consisted of a series of mud-brick structures, including barracks for soldiers and storage rooms for weapons, food, and provisions. Inside the food stores, the team found large granaries, pottery storage vessels with the remains of fish and animal bones, and cylindrical pottery ovens. A cow burial was discovered nearby.

The newly discovered military fort at Tell el-Abqain.

The soldiers also left behind many personal items, including weapons, hunting tools, jewellery, kohl applicators, protective amulets, and one bronze sword bearing the cartouche of Ramesses II, which may have been presented by the king to a high-ranking officer. A limestone block bearing the titles of the king was discovered, too, together with a second block naming an official called Bay.
